Kolkata ITAT Deletes Penalty under Section 271(1)(c) After Quantum Additions Were Fully Deleted

The Kolkata ITAT deleted the penalty of ₹2.61 crore levied under section 271(1)(c) after observing that the very foundation for the penalty had ceased to exist. The Tribunal noted that the original assessment had resulted in substantial additions, which were subsequently challenged before the Tribunal. While an earlier order had restored one issue relating to property valuation to the Assessing Officer, the Tribunal, in a subsequent quantum appeal, deleted the surviving addition as well, leaving no addition outstanding against the assessee. Since the penalty proceedings were entirely based on additions that no longer survived, the Tribunal held that the penalty had no legs to stand on and was liable to be deleted. Accordingly, the penalty under section 271(1)(c) was quashed in its entirety.
